Edge Profiles
A finished edge on your countertops is the final touch to making your granite look like work of art! Here are our most popular edges!
The Bevel Edge
An angled edge. Available in 3cm or 4cm
The Double Bevel Edge
An angled cut to both the top and bottom edges. Available in 2cm, 3cm, 4cm
The Bullnose Edge
Deeply rounded at the top and bottom. Available in 2cm, 3cm, 4cm or 6cm
The Demi Bullnose Edge
Softly rounded on the top. Available in 2cm, 3cm, or 4cm
The Eased Edge
This edge is beveled, not rounded, at the top. Available in 2cm, 3cm, 4cm
The Mitered Edge
The mitered edge is an edge assembled from two pieces, to give a countertop with less weight the appearance of a much heavier one. Available in 2cm, 3cm.

The Benefits of Choosing Prefab Granite

Prefab… what exactly does ‘Prefab’ granite mean? What are the differences between prefab and custom granite installation? Is there an advantage in doing one or the other? Educating yourself about natural stone is very important before you have any type of stone installed in your home.
Prefab granite is 100% natural stone and comes in the highest quality here at Premium Granite. Some of the main advantages of using prefab granite are a very quick installation time, it’s more cost effective for the customer, and the large selection we have to offer will suit everyone’s style. Prefab granite comes precut to fit standard kitchen and bathroom cabinets as well as wider pre-edged pieces to accommodate bar tops, breakfast nooks, islands and peninsulas. Since the pieces come precut and edged, this saves on fabrication cost and time.
Choosing prefab is a quicker and less expensive option, but using custom slabs is always an option. If the job is large enough and the waste not too excessive, using raw un-edged slabs is a choice option, if it fits your remodeling budget. With prefab granite, you are getting the same beauty and quality as a custom slab, with a shorter order and installation time and less of an impact on your pocket book.
